Preparing for an open home

One of the most important steps in the process of selling real estate is staging an open home, in order to give prospective buyers a chance to assess the property for themselves.
The success of your open home can go a long way towards determining just how successful you are when selling your property, so it is vital that you give this job the attention that it deserves.
If you are considering selling Inner West real estate, make sure you read up on these top tips for getting the best possible result out of your open home.
Clean and tidy
It might sound obvious, but the importance of presenting your property in a clean and tidy state cannot be understated. You'll want to paint your home in the best possible light, so make sure every room has been vacuumed and polished.
It's often a good idea to remove any particularly personal belongings from the main living rooms, such as large family portraits or sentimental artworks. This will help attendants to envision themselves living in the property.
Maximise curb appeal
You only get one chance at a first impression, so it's important to make it count. Maximise the curb appeal of your home by giving the front yard a thorough clean, and ensure that the lawn is trimmed and neat.

Use the weather to your advantage
It's a good idea to be flexible on open home day and be prepared to adjust your strategy based on the weather conditions.
For example, if it is bright and sunny, throw open the windows and let in the fresh air and sunshine. Alternatively, if it is raining, why not make use of your fireplace or heater to create a warm, cosy and inviting environment?
